Black Box LES1532A 32-Port RS-232 RJ45 Cisco Pinout Console Server
Overview
The Black Box LES1532A is a 32-port serial console server built around RS-232 RJ-45 connectivity with Cisco-standard pinout — the configuration that matches the console ports found on the majority of Cisco routers, switches, and firewalls deployed in enterprise and data center environments. When your network gear goes dark and SSH won't reach it, this is the device that gets you in without rolling a truck.
Console servers exist to solve a specific problem: out-of-band (OOB) management access that remains reachable when the in-band network is down. The LES1532A provides 32 independent RS-232 serial channels, so a single rack-mounted unit can cover an entire cabinet of managed switches, routers, or other devices with console ports — eliminating the need for individual serial cables run back to a crash cart.
Key Features
- 32 RS-232 Serial Ports: Each port is independently addressable, so you can reach any managed device in the rack without disrupting the others — critical when one node is wedged during a change window.
- RJ-45 Serial Connectors with Cisco Pinout: Native Cisco pinout means the LES1532A connects directly to Cisco console ports without adapters or rollover cables in most deployments, reducing cable clutter and failure points in high-density racks.
- RS-232 Serial Standard: RS-232 is the universal baseline for console port access across Cisco, Juniper, Arista, HPE, and most managed network hardware — the LES1532A speaks the same language as virtually every device in your stack.
- Black Rackmount Form Factor: The black chassis is sized for standard data center rack deployment, keeping the management plane organized in the same cabinet as the devices it monitors.
- Out-of-Band Management Architecture: Separating management traffic from production traffic means a misconfigured ACL or routing loop that kills in-band access doesn't also kill your recovery path.
- High Port Density: 32 ports in a single unit reduces per-port cost and rack space compared to deploying multiple lower-density units or maintaining a dedicated console terminal per device.

The LES1532A earns its place in any data center where Cisco gear dominates the rack. The Cisco-pinout RJ-45 ports are the deciding spec here — in a mixed-vendor environment you'll still need adapters for non-Cisco devices, but if your cabinets are predominantly IOS or NX-OS gear, the LES1532A eliminates the rollover cable inventory and adapter drawer that follow every other console server into the room.
Technical Highlights:
- 32 RS-232 Ports: High-density serial access for full-cabinet coverage from a single rackmount unit — reduces the unit count and management overhead compared to deploying multiple 8- or 16-port alternatives.
- Cisco RJ-45 Pinout: Direct connection to Cisco console ports without rollover cables or DB9 adapters in standard Cisco environments — fewer failure points during a 2 a.m. recovery event.
- RS-232 Serial Standard: RS-232 compatibility ensures the LES1532A works with virtually every enterprise networking device class that ships with a physical console port, not just Cisco gear.
Deployment Considerations:
- Verify the pinout against non-Cisco devices before purchasing — Juniper and some HPE platforms use RJ-45 console ports but with different pinouts that may require a short adapter.
- The LES1532A is optimized for environments where Cisco-standard pinout is the dominant requirement; mixed-vendor racks with heavy Juniper or Arista presence may need additional cabling planned per device.
The LES1532A is the right unit for a data center or NOC environment running 20–32 Cisco devices per cabinet and needing reliable, no-adapter OOB console access without the complexity of per-device serial infrastructure.
